Detailed Ingredients with measures
– Puff pastry: 1 sheet
– Ripe bananas: 2
– Nescafé Dolce Gusto coffee: 1 capsule
– Milk: 100 ml
– Sugar: 2 tablespoons
– Egg yolk: 1 (for brushing)
– Ground cinnamon: a pinch
Prep Time
20 minutes
Cook Time, Total Time, Yield
Cook Time: 15 minutes
Total Time: 35 minutes
Yield: Serves 4
Detailed Directions and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Bananas
Peel and slice the bananas into thin rounds. Set aside for later use.
Step 2: Prepare the Coffee
Brew your Nescafé Dolce Gusto coffee according to the machine’s instructions. Ensure it is strong enough for the recipe.
Step 3: Make the Pastry Base
Preheat your oven to 200°C (392°F). Roll out the puff pastry on a lightly floured surface, ensuring it is uniform in thickness.
Step 4: Assemble the Layers
Cut the puff pastry into squares or rectangles. Place a layer of banana slices in the center of each pastry piece. Drizzle a small amount of brewed coffee over the bananas.
Step 5: Seal the Pastries
Fold the edges of the pastry over the filling, pinching them together to seal the pastry tightly. You can use a fork to press down the edges for a decorative finish.
Step 6: Brush with Egg Wash
In a small bowl, beat an egg and brush the egg wash over the top of each pastry to achieve a golden color while baking.
Step 7: Bake the Pastries
Place the pastries on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Bake in the preheated oven for about 15-20 minutes or until they turn golden brown and flaky.
Step 8: Serve and Enjoy
Once baked, remove the pastries from the oven and let them cool slightly before serving. Enjoy them warm as a delightful snack or dessert.
Notes
Note 1: Serving Suggestions
Consider serving the pastries with a dollop of whipped cream or a drizzle of chocolate sauce for added sweetness.
Note 2: Variations
You can add nuts or chocolate chips to the banana filling for extra flavor and texture.
Note 3: Storage
These pastries are best enjoyed fresh but can be stored in an airtight container for a couple of days at room temperature. Reheat to restore crispness.

FAQ
Can I use store-bought puff pastry?
Yes, store-bought puff pastry can be a convenient alternative to making it from scratch and will yield good results.
What type of bananas are best for this recipe?
Ripe bananas are ideal as they provide the best flavor and sweetness for baking.
Can I substitute coffee for another flavor?
Yes, you can substitute coffee with other flavors such as chocolate or caramel, depending on your preference.
How do I know when the pastry is done baking?
The pastry is done when it is puffed up and golden brown, usually after about 20-25 minutes in a preheated oven.
Can I freeze the assembled pastries before baking?
Yes, you can freeze the assembled pastries. Just be sure to wrap them tightly and bake them from frozen, adding a few extra minutes to the baking time.
